As we focus on God's sublime care and concern for His own, we should take great comfort in knowing that God preserves us in the midst of troubling times. In fact, God always preserves us whether we are fully aware of that or not. He preserves us to the day when we will see Him face to face and He preserves us in the midst of all the trials that the enemy can throw at us. This does not mean that we ourselves will not experience difficulties. It means we will not experience His judgment and He will make a way for us to continue to receive His blessings in the midst of His judgment.
